in the 2004041208 build on XP Pro, when I launch Mozilla, the personal tool bar is not displayed until I do "manage bookmarks". Then they appear, but clicking any bookmark does not do anything. Clicking the bookmark from the Manage Bookmarks list does work. Selecting a bookmark from the bookmark menu item does not work either!

The 4/8 build works. 4/11 did not. This is without changing my prefs.js, so I am not sure the 240288 comment is relevent.
It's The One. The fix causing this was checked in 2004-04-10. (bug 230219 comment 13). I built with it right away (on Linux) and got the exact symptoms you describe. In addition, the >> to the right of personal toolbar vanished, pushed out of sight when there were "too many" bookmarks there.
Same thing happens on Linux/2004041407. Bookmarks appear again by opening the bookmarks tab in the sidebar.
